Technical Specifications

Molecular FormulaC30H32NOP
Molecular Weight453.22214 g/mol
XLogP6.3
Topological Polar Surface Area (TPSA)20.3 Ų
Hydrogen Bond Donors0
Hydrogen Bond Acceptors2
Rotatable Bonds9
Exact Mass453.22214 Da
Heavy Atoms33
Complexity567.0
SMILESCN(C)CCCC(C1=CC=CC=C1)(C2=CC=CC=C2)P(=O)(C3=CC=CC=C3)C4=CC=CC=C4
InChIKeyYSDJZUSXOAPETJ-UHFFFAOYSA-N

Property Insights of 4-(Diphenylphosphoryl)-N,N-dimethyl-4,4-diphenylbutan-1-amine

The XLogP value of 6.3 indicates that 4-(Diphenylphosphoryl)-N,N-dimethyl-4,4-diphenylbutan-1-amine is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. With a topological polar surface area (TPSA) of 20.3 Ų, 4-(Diphenylphosphoryl)-N,N-dimethyl-4,4-diphenylbutan-1-amine ex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, 4-(Diphenylphosphoryl)-N,N-dimethyl-4,4-diphenylbutan-1-amine has 0 hydrogen bond donor(s) and 2 hydrogen bond acceptor(s), which may warrant consideration for formulation optimization.
